From b17eee593664ccc4f669efb648ffca2208549a91 Mon Sep 17 00:00:00 2001 From: Seth Call Date: Thu, 11 Jan 2018 06:00:32 -0600 Subject: [PATCH] fix bug with admin --- ruby/lib/jam_ruby/models/lesson_session.rb | 15 ++++++++++++--- 1 file changed, 12 insertions(+), 3 deletions(-) diff --git a/ruby/lib/jam_ruby/models/lesson_session.rb b/ruby/lib/jam_ruby/models/lesson_session.rb index 0e3f87051..67ddc40f2 100644 --- a/ruby/lib/jam_ruby/models/lesson_session.rb +++ b/ruby/lib/jam_ruby/models/lesson_session.rb @@ -1065,14 +1065,23 @@ module JamRuby lesson_booking.lesson_package_type.description(lesson_booking) + " with #{teacher.admin_name}" end + def time_for_admin + if self.scheduled_start + self.scheduled_start.to_date.strftime('%B %d, %Y') + else + 'TBD' + end + + + end def timed_description if is_test_drive? - "TestDrive session with #{self.lesson_booking.student.name} on #{self.scheduled_start.to_date.strftime('%B %d, %Y')}" + "TestDrive session with #{self.lesson_booking.student.name} on #{time_for_admin}" else if self.lesson_booking.is_monthly_payment? - "Monthly Lesson with #{self.lesson_booking.student.name} on #{self.scheduled_start.to_date.strftime('%B %d, %Y')}" + "Monthly Lesson with #{self.lesson_booking.student.name} on #{time_for_admin}" else - "Lesson with #{self.lesson_booking.student.name} on #{self.scheduled_start.to_date.strftime('%B %d, %Y')}" + "Lesson with #{self.lesson_booking.student.name} on #{time_for_admin}" end end end